A high grade is not an allegation. Every input is public, and buying into an industry you work on daily is ordinary expertise. What the trade actually returned is deliberately excluded from this score and shown separately below.
It is also not a forecast. Measured across every settled trade, A-graded ones did not beat E-graded ones to any significant degree — the method page prints the table. This score says a trade looks like a decision rather than administration, and nothing more.

Intel Corporation
Intel Corporation designs, develops, manufactures, markets, sells, and services computing and related end products and services in the United States, Ireland, Israel, and internationally. It operates through three segments: CCG, DCAI, and Intel Foundry.
